Treginnis Walk from Porthclais, PembrokeWalking route9.6 km▾
Walk around the rocky, undulating headlands of Treginnis & be rewarded with views of Skomer & Ramsay. You'll see some of Wales’s oldest rock formations – dating back over 600 million years – & pass an iron-age fort & elics of a 19th-century copper mine.
St David's Head Coastal Walk, PembrokeWalking route6 km▾
Explore Pembroke’s dramatic coastal headland on this rugged circular a few miles from St David’s, Wales’s smallest city. Look out to an island-dotted seascape as you walk across a wild landscape of rocky outcrops, prehistoric monuments & coastal wildlife.
